I contacted BlaBla for their comments regarding passenger safety and this is their reply:-

Quote:
Hello,

Thank you for contacting us.

Trust is one of the pillars of the BlaBlaCar network's car sharing community, and we place particular emphasis upon building and comforting it.

You may have noticed already that some trips mention the “ratings” of people who already travelled with the member who published the trip offer. This allows you to access the feedback of previous car sharers who met this person and travelled with them. Furthermore, photos and preferences also help you choosing your trip, so that you can use as much information as we can provide before you choose.

If this is your first car share and you feel an apprehension, we advise you choose a person that is used to our website, with one or several positive ratings. Otherwise, do not hesitate to phone them, possibly twice, in order to have a chat with them and ask them all the questions you need to know the answers of before the trip : exact meeting point, time, trip's conditions, scheduled arrival, drop-off point, model of the car, experience with the website, the kind of music that's on, if the driver is looking to take any breaks, etc...
